Hot Fuel Fruit Punch

Product Type:Functional: Energy Drink: Regular; Container: 24 oz resealable PET with lugnut cap
BevNET Review: Nitrous Express’ “Hot Fuel” variety is a fruit punch-flavored energy drink enhanced with quercetin, caffeine, and vitamins. The highly carbonated formulation has a consistency reminiscent of dairy. The added thickness and the sugar used to sweeten the product give it a nice tangy bite that’s enjoyable to drink. Functionally, the product relies on quercetin and caffeine, with 240mg of the latter per 24 oz. bottle. Quercetin, which they’ve billed on the front of the bottle, is also added for energy benefits. However, unlike caffeine, this is not something that’s easily to evaluate, especially when it comes to the product having the “crashproof” abilities boasted on the drink’s label. In any event, it makes for a nice call out, especially as quercetin has a naturally functional sound. Visually, the product offers a nice alternative to NOS, the only other brand using this type of bottle. And since NOS has had success with it, there’s no shame in Nitrous Express trying to create their own version of it. The label is colorful and edgy, with a hexagonal twist cap. While it’s immediately identifiable as an energy drink, the flavor name, in small text in the bottom right, could be a bit more prominent. Overall, this product is one of the better large format energy drinks that we’ve tried, especially with its unique flavor and ingredients. Reviewed on: 4/22/2010

Lean & Mean Mango Citrus

Product Type:Functional: Energy Drink: Regular; Container: 24 oz resealable PET, with lugnut cap
BevNET Review: The Lean & Mean variety of Nitrous Express is the lone sugar free flavor of the Nitrous Oxide lineup. In place of sugar, the product uses a sucralose and acesulfame potassium blend, which achieves a calorie and sugar free formulation with minimal aftertaste. The product is otherwise identical to the Speed Freak variety, complete with a pleasant sweet and sour tropical fruit flavor that the company calls “mango citrus.” The functional blend includes 80mg of caffeine per serving (240mg per bottle), 250mg of pure quercetin, and 250mg of vitamin C (417% RDA). With that amount of caffeine, there’s definitely some kick to the product, while the added quercetin is certainly going to take some further explanation and education. That’s okay – especially when the product should be effective based on the caffeine alone. On the outside, they could do a bit more to call attention to this being a low calorie offering, and placing the flavor more prominently would be good. Otherwise, this is a solid low calorie offering. Reviewed on: 4/22/2010

Speed Freak Mango Citrus

Product Type:Functional: Energy Drink: Regular; Container: 24 oz resealable PET, with lugnut cap
BevNET Review: Speak Freak, which is the brand’s “mango citrus” flavor, is a caffeine and quercetin enhanced energy drink. The flavor is sweet and sour, with a candy like fruit note a light bite to the finish. The cloudy green liquid has a rather high amount of carbonation to it. All in all, it’s a very drinkable and unique tasting product. Functionally, the products has 80mg of caffeine per serving (240mg per bottle), 250mg of pure quercetin, and 250mg of vitamin C (417% RDA). There’s some definite kick to the product, especially if you consume more than the allotted 8 ounces per serving. Packaging is a big, 24 oz. bottle with a cap shaped like a hex nut. The silver backed label is shiny, with aggressive graphics clearly aimed at males and auto enthusiasts who might already be familiar with the Nitrous Express brand (they make nitrous oxide systems). The front panel is clean and catches the eye, although we’d like to see the flavor name more prominently placed on the label. Overall, a well rounded product that balances flavor, function, and packaging.Reviewed on: 4/22/2010
